Output 5b408f0a56a0551d228043e38deff1dcbe3eec7d985fb5c7e4eea1a8effc5ca0:0

value
525543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ac9176f8f29f9bb4607aec357687f28458940a8e OP_EQUAL
address
3HRUQc5depRJ1BkVDR7uDKrDY7RkaL2xcP
transaction
5b408f0a56a0551d228043e38deff1dcbe3eec7d985fb5c7e4eea1a8effc5ca0
confirmations
171069
spent
true